Arthroscopic Repair of the Glenoid Labrum

This stock medical exhibit demonstrates an arthroscopic procedure for repairing the glenoid labrum. The first image gives an initial orientation and portal placement for arthroscopic instrumentation. The next graphic illustrates the debridement of the margins of the anterior glenoid and partial Benkart lesion. Then, the stapling of the free margin of the labrum to the glenoid is shown. Finally, instrument removal and portal closure with sutures is displayed.
